Shobu Aiki Kai

A TOMIKI AIKIDO organization established by Steven DUNCAN in 1987 which groups together former students of Karl GEIS and which has adopted Geis’ non-competitive approach to Tomiki Aikido. A sister organization of...

Shirataki 白滝

A small town in the northern part of Hokkaido where Morihei UESHIBA lived from 1912-1919. Ueshiba played a leadership role in the clearing of the land and settling of this town as part of a group of colonizers from...

Gozo Shioda 塩田剛三

(9 September 1915-17 July 1994). Also Takeshi. B. Tokyo. Founder of YOSHINKAN AIKIDO. Graduate of Takushoku University. Studied judo and kendo as a youth. Entered the KOBUKAN DOJO in 1932 where he studied for eight...
